Tuesday- Jason got his port put in bright n early that morning, after that we met up with our drs, just to check up with them, they asked how everything was going, how jason was feeling, ya know..the works. we met our oncologist {he was on vacation last time we were down there} after meeting with all the drs, jason got chemo!! it takes about 1.5 hours, then we are free to leave... they pump him full of anti nausea drugs before the chemo to help keep him feeling good, and luckily it did the job! he didnt say he felt crappy, just the usual...tired and exhausted. after chemo and everything timari {cousin} picked us up and took us out to the drive in movie, we watched despicable me, it is uber cute!! it was my first drive in movie and overall it was great, but it was friggin HOTT!!!

wednesday- Jason had a PFT {pulmonary function test} it took a little over an hour. He had to sit in a funky little tube type thing and breath. after that we went to the hotel, jason wasnt feeling too well, so we pretty much passed out...

Thursday- we had no appointments so we pretty much just hung out at the hotel all day, i wanted to go swimming but since jason had his port put in he couldnt...so we didnt go. we were supposed to have dinner with radar but dar had a migraine so hopefully next time we can meet up with them along with Lauren and josh!! {and have to meet them eventually!!!} so we ended up at timari's :)

Friday- jason had an evaluation with occupational therapy, to test his muscle strength n such, and everyone seems to be amazed at how much he can do {he does everything he did before his sickness, just doesnt work as much} at first the therapist said that she didnt think jason would need any appointments with them, she would just give him a few things to do at home, she had him lift some 10 lb weights, which he did like normal, but his heart rate went up..fast, so next time we go down we will make appointments with them to get him movin a little bit more. after the appointment with therapy, we were done...and got to come home! :)

We go back down to Arizona every 3 weeks for treatment. we have blood work drawn once a week here and faxed down there to keep an eye on his blood counts.
